首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用ImageMagick的mpr和Node.js中的衍生批量调整大小

ImageMagick是一款开源的图像处理软件,它提供了丰富的功能和工具,可以用于图像的编辑、转换、合成等操作。其中,mpr是ImageMagick中的一种特殊格式,用于存储多个图像处理操作的序列。

Node.js是一种基于Chrome V8引擎的JavaScript运行环境,可以用于开发服务器端和网络应用。在Node.js中,可以使用child_process模块来创建子进程,并通过衍生(spawn)的方式执行命令行操作。

衍生批量调整大小是指通过Node.js中的child_process模块衍生(spawn)ImageMagick的命令行工具,实现对多个图像进行批量调整大小的操作。

具体实现步骤如下:

  1. 在Node.js中引入child_process模块。
  2. 使用child_process.spawn方法衍生ImageMagick的命令行工具,并传入相应的参数,包括mpr文件路径和调整大小的参数。
  3. 监听子进程的stdout和stderr事件,获取命令行工具的输出信息和错误信息。
  4. 根据需要,可以将调整大小后的图像保存到指定的目录。

衍生批量调整大小的优势在于可以通过编程的方式自动化处理大量的图像,提高工作效率。它适用于需要对大量图像进行批量处理的场景,比如图片压缩、生成缩略图等。

腾讯云提供了云服务器(CVM)和函数计算(SCF)等产品,可以用于部署和运行Node.js应用。同时,腾讯云还提供了对象存储(COS)和内容分发网络(CDN)等产品,用于存储和加速图像文件的访问。

相关产品和产品介绍链接地址:

  1. 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  2. 腾讯云函数计算(SCF):https://cloud.tencent.com/product/scf
  3. 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  4. 腾讯云内容分发网络(CDN):https://cloud.tencent.com/product/cdn

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分28秒

PS小白教程:如何在Photoshop中制作出镂空文字?

11分33秒

061.go数组的使用场景

4分32秒

PS小白教程:如何在Photoshop中使用蒙版工具插入图片?

54秒

PS小白教程:如何在Photoshop中制作出光晕效果?

8分3秒

Windows NTFS 16T分区上限如何破,无损调整块大小到8192的需求如何实现?

53秒

动态环境下机器人运动规划与控制有移动障碍物的无人机动画2

4分29秒

MySQL命令行监控工具 - mysqlstat 介绍

34秒

动态环境下机器人运动规划与控制有移动障碍物的无人机动画

2分29秒

基于实时模型强化学习的无人机自主导航

1分4秒

光学雨量计关于降雨测量误差

31分41秒

【玩转 WordPress】腾讯云serverless搭建WordPress个人博经验分享

领券